2 JANUARY 9 1979 <br /> MOTION: Irsfeld made motion, seconded by Schletty, that the Mobile Home Permit <br /> for Joe Niemczyk, 7666 170th Street North, be extended for 90 days, under <br /> Chapter 40, Article III, Subdivision D. <br /> VOTING FOR: LaValle, Spitzer, Schletty, Irsfeld and Vail <br /> MOTION CARRIED <br /> 5.4 Stan's Withrow Junction - License for Game of Skill <br /> MOTION: Spitzer made motion, seconded by Irsfeld, to grant a license for Games of <br /> Skill to Twin City Novelty at STAN's WITHROW JUNCTION, 12020 Keystone <br /> Avenue, <br /> VOTING FOR: LaValle, Spitzer, Schletty, Irsfeld, and Vail <br /> MOTION CARRIED <br /> 5.5 Safeway House Movers_- Amended Special Use Permit <br /> Mr. Sempel is requesting approval to move in a 24' x 60' building to be used for cold <br /> storage. The Planning Commission recommended approval, but acted on a Site Plan <br /> Approval rather than an Amended Special Use Permit, <br /> MOTION: Spitzer made motion, seconded by Schletty, to approve the Amended <br /> Special Use Permit for Safeway House Movers, to move in and set perm- <br /> anently a 24" x 60' building to be -used for cold storage relating to <br /> the business. <br /> VOTING FOR: LaValle, Spitzer, Schletty, Irsfeld and Vail <br /> MOTION CARRIED <br /> Mr. Sempel has plans of moving in more buildings, and he was instructed to draw up <br /> a site plan indicating what his plans are for the property. <br /> 6.0 REPORTS OF OFFICERS & COMMITTEES <br /> 6.1 Ordinance Committee <br /> Attorney Johnson suggested that a joint meeting be held to discuss the proposed Sub- <br /> division Ordinance, <br /> MOTION: LaValle made motion, seconded by Irsfeld, to have a Special Meeting of <br /> the Hugo City Council, in conjunction with the Ordinance Committee, for <br /> January 17, 1979, at 7:00 PM, to discuss the proposed Subdivision <br /> Ordinance, <br /> VOTING FOR: LaValle, Spitzer, Schletty, Irsfeld and Vail <br /> MOTION CARRIED <br /> 6.2 Planning Commission <br /> McAllister stated that the Planning Commission is exploring the possibility of incor- <br /> porating watchman's quarters into the ordinance. Spitzer stated that a definition of <br /> "watchman's quarter's" could not be agreed upon, and that it could become an apart- <br /> ment. The ordinance could be changed by allowing a- special Use Permit. <br />
